>>56521924
Not him also, but I'm going to comment on this subject.

>Omega is 20% of Rolex effort for 80% of Rolex prices.

Are you sure? What's your source of this info? And more importantly, are you talking from experience? Have you ever owned either of the two?

Omega is a brand with a marketing department full of bullshit, yes, but also is Rolex. Have you seen the "It's takes a whole year to make a Rolex" campaign?

That doesn't mean any of those two make bad watches. On the contrary, both made excelent tiempieces for the price asked, but Omega actually delivers more bang for your money.

For example, the finishing of the movement of my sapphire sandwich Speedy is quite better than the finishing of any sport movement from Rolex, both being sold as "instrument watches" both Omega is considerably cheaper; Cellini being the obvious exception, being at a tie.

Don't judge Omega solely on the basis that it now belongs to Swatch and the bad things said on the internet, you should buy one and I guarantee you'll change your mind the moment you strap it on your wrist.

>Swatch Omega is unfit to even be mentioned in the same breath as JLC

I keep both my Omegas and my JLCs in the same drawer in my vault, and they both belong there.

>>56525437
The Seiko group consist of three brands: Seiko Holdings company (the watch brand), Seiko Instruments Incorporated (they make a lot of the movement technology), and Seiko Epson (they own Orient) All three are run separately with only some shareholders in common.
>>
>>56525476
>>56525437
OK I wasn't quite right, SII is now owned wholly by Seiko Holdings but Epson is still independent and by extension so is Orient.
>>
>>56525476
I don't think that's how Japanese businesses work but ok.
>>
>>56525552
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Seiko_Epson

>Even though Seiko Holdings and Seiko Epson have some common shareholders including the key members of the Hattori family, they are not affiliated. They are managed and operated completely independently.

>>56527753
There are no straight chink copies but there are fake parts like the blue dial and hands pictured while the rest of the watch was procured elsewhere, with rumors pointing to being stolen from the factory during hardship or something of that nature. The other two ones previously posted are frankensteins. An all original Raketa is only worth around $60 in good shape depending on exact model, so imagine what a shit fraken one *should* be worth.
>>
>>56527921
>There are no straight chink copies
Brand new cases and dials and non-Raketa movement would say otherwise. They're only sold on one website though and not really widespread on ebay.
>>
I think im going to have to throw this fake mihil tourbillion away.

I have to get to the front to fix a loose piece but after seeing this shit I dont think I can do it. I already dont know how to assemble it back together.
>>
>>56527932
Not widespread on Ebay? There are tons of these questionable watches there. An exact copy of the case or movement isn't likely for the Chinese, but perhaps modified like the converted 12 to 24 hour movements found on these watches being a good example. The current Raketa company has openly condemned these watches before, meaning large numbers of parts escaped the factory at some point, and possibly they're trying to hide their previous dubious attempts at saving the company from going under.

>>56526339
If you want a really cheap mechanical, save some $30 more and get a Vostok Amphibia for $55 + $15 shipping. I wouldnt recommend any mechanicals from China under $100 (some affordable but QC-ed SeaGulls at least), and Vostok truly is the cheapest of the cheap but still quite regulatable. You can get it to up to 5 secs +- per day, after a month or two.
That, or get a vintage swiss mechanical and get it serviced and regulated, but you wont have a decent cheap mechanical for under $70 anyway.
